Your DTI isn't included in your credit score, but it's still a major aspect of your creditworthiness when applying for a mortgage loan. In general, mortgage lenders want your DTI to be less than 43%, though some loan programs go as high as 50%.

Feb 7, 2022 · The beginning of the month is usually the best time to meet with a mortgage lender. Mortgage lenders fit in the most applications for approval during the first week, while the middle of the month is used to gather all the documentation needed to complete the process. Any extra money that goes toward the mortgage reduces the...You must be at least 18 years old to be approved for a residential mortgage, and 21 years old for a Buy to Let mortgage. Some lenders may also have maximum age limits, as older applicants can be seen as a higher risk.
